Package: ftp.debian.org
Severity: normal
The Rmetrics project has phased out fCalendar (aka r-cran-fcalendar in
Debian) and we have long had the replacement package timeDate (aka
r-cran-timedate) available. The only other dependency is fSeries which will
also be removed (bug will be filed
